编程前端都需要学什么知识

回复

共3条回复 我来回复
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    编程前端需要学习以下知识:

    1. HTML(超文本标记语言):HTML是构建网页的基础,学习HTML可以了解网页的结构和内容,包括标签、元素、属性等基本概念。

    2. CSS(层叠样式表):CSS用于控制网页的样式和布局,学习CSS可以实现网页的美化和排版,包括选择器、属性、盒模型等。

    3. JavaScript:JavaScript是一种脚本语言,用于给网页增加动态和交互性。学习JavaScript可以实现网页的动态效果、表单验证、DOM操作等。

    4. 前端框架:前端框架是一种工具,用于简化和加速前端开发。常见的前端框架有React、Vue、Angular等,学习这些框架可以提高开发效率。

    5. 响应式设计:响应式设计是一种网页设计方法,可以使网页在不同设备上(如手机、平板、电脑)都能良好展示。学习响应式设计可以提供更好的用户体验。

    6. 浏览器开发工具:学习使用浏览器开发工具(如Chrome DevTools)可以帮助调试和优化网页,提高开发效率。

    7. 版本控制:学习使用版本控制工具(如Git)可以管理代码的版本,方便团队合作和代码回滚。

    8. 网络基础知识:了解HTTP协议、网络请求、服务器响应等基础知识对于前端开发也是很重要的。

    9. UI/UX设计:学习一些UI/UX设计的基本原则可以提高网页的用户体验,包括颜色搭配、布局、可用性等。

    10. 前端性能优化:学习前端性能优化的方法可以提升网页的加载速度和响应速度,包括压缩代码、减少请求、使用缓存等。

    总之,编程前端需要学习HTML、CSS、JavaScript等基础知识,掌握前端框架和开发工具,并了解一些设计和性能优化的原则。不断学习和实践,才能成为一名优秀的前端开发工程师。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    学习编程前端需要掌握以下几个方面的知识:

    1. HTML(超文本标记语言):HTML是构建网页的基础语言,前端开发人员需要熟悉HTML的标签和语法,以及如何使用HTML创建网页的结构和内容。

    2. CSS(层叠样式表):CSS用于控制网页的样式和布局,前端开发人员需要学习CSS的选择器、属性和值,以及如何使用CSS来美化网页并实现响应式布局。

    3. JavaScript(JS):JavaScript是一种脚本语言,用于为网页添加交互和动态效果。前端开发人员需要学习JS的语法、变量、函数、DOM操作等,以及如何使用JS来实现表单验证、动画效果、页面逻辑等。

    4. 前端框架和库:前端开发人员可以学习一些流行的前端框架和库,例如React、Angular、Vue等。这些框架和库可以帮助开发人员更高效地开发复杂的前端应用,提供了一些常用的组件和功能。

    5. 响应式设计和移动优先:随着移动设备的普及,前端开发人员需要学习如何设计和开发适应不同屏幕大小和设备的响应式网页。同时,移动优先的设计原则也需要被考虑,确保网页在移动设备上有良好的用户体验。

    6. 浏览器和调试工具:前端开发人员需要了解不同浏览器的特性和兼容性,以确保网页在不同浏览器上都能正常运行。同时,掌握一些调试工具,如浏览器的开发者工具、调试插件等,可以帮助开发人员快速定位和解决问题。

    7. 版本控制和协作工具:在团队协作开发中,前端开发人员需要学习使用版本控制工具,如Git,来管理代码的版本和变更。同时,掌握一些协作工具,如GitHub、GitLab等,可以方便团队成员之间的代码分享和合作。

    总结起来,学习编程前端需要掌握HTML、CSS、JavaScript等基础知识,了解前端框架和库,熟悉响应式设计和移动优先原则,掌握浏览器和调试工具,以及了解版本控制和协作工具的使用。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    编程前端涉及的知识点很广泛,需要掌握一系列的技术和工具。下面是一些常见的前端知识点:

    1. HTML:超文本标记语言,用于构建网页结构和内容。

    2. CSS:层叠样式表,用于控制网页的样式和布局。

    3. JavaScript:一种脚本语言,用于实现网页的交互和动态效果。

    4. 前端框架:如React、Vue等,用于简化前端开发过程。

    5. HTTP协议:用于在客户端和服务器之间传输数据。

    6. 浏览器开发工具:如Chrome开发者工具,用于调试和优化网页。

    7. 跨浏览器兼容性:不同浏览器对网页的解析和渲染可能存在差异,需要考虑兼容性问题。

    8. 响应式设计:使网页能够在不同设备上有良好的显示效果。

    9. 移动端开发:了解移动端的特性和开发方式,如响应式设计、移动端布局等。

    10. 数据交互:通过AJAX、Fetch等技术与服务器进行数据交互。

    11. 前端工程化:使用构建工具(如Webpack)和模块化的开发方式,提高开发效率和代码质量。

    12. 前端性能优化:通过压缩代码、合并文件、缓存等手段提高网页的加载速度和性能。

    13. 前端安全:了解常见的前端安全问题,如XSS、CSRF等,以及相应的防护措施。

    14. 版本控制:使用Git等工具管理代码的版本和协作开发。

    15. UI/UX设计:了解基本的用户界面和用户体验设计原则,提供良好的用户体验。

    以上只是前端开发的一部分知识点,还有很多其他的技术和工具,需要根据具体需求和项目进行学习和实践。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部